Support Assemblies and Crank Mechanisms
Crank mechanisms play a surprisingly important role in the modern design of adjustable bed structures. These clever parts allow for a broad range of adjustments to the mattress's position, meeting to individual preferences for relaxation or medical requirements. The standard lever system utilizes a series of wheels and linkages, driven by a manual crank, to precisely lift or decrease parts of the support. This layout offers a robust and relatively uncomplicated resolution for achieving comfortable reposing positions, often found in hospital couches and increasingly in home furniture.

Integrating Cabinet Design with Wheels
The modern bedroom increasingly demands functional furniture, and the integration of casters into cabinet designs represents a significant trend. Historically, cabinet units were static, fixed pieces; however, the addition of wheels unlocks unprecedented mobility, allowing for repositioning the unit to fit different needs—whether it’s cleaning, redecorating the space, or simply modifying the room’s layout. Designers are now investigating various approaches, from fully hidden rollers for a seamless aesthetic to apparent designs that offer a more utilitarian look. Material selection plays a key role; the rollers must be appropriate with the nightstand's weight and floor surface to ensure smooth operation and prevent damage. Ultimately, a successful nightstand with casters is a testament to thoughtful engineering that emphasizes both form and use.
